Node.js是一个基于Chrome V8引擎的JavaScript运行环境,可以在服务器端运行JavaScript代码。它具有高效的I/O操作和事件驱动的特性,适合处理高并发的网络应用。
在发布大量数据(10MB)时,可以使用以下方法:
fs.createReadStream
读取文件并使用response.write
逐块发送给客户端。zlib
模块,可以使用其提供的压缩算法对数据进行压缩,例如使用zlib.createGzip
创建压缩流,并将压缩后的数据发送给客户端。node-cache
。http
模块创建多个并行的HTTP请求,将数据分块发送给客户端。腾讯云相关产品和产品介绍链接地址:
以上是关于Node.js发布大量数据的一些方法和腾讯云相关产品的介绍。希望对您有帮助!
腾讯云湖存储专题直播
云+社区沙龙online [国产数据库]
云+社区沙龙online [国产数据库]
腾讯云存储知识小课堂
云+社区沙龙online[数据工匠]
云+社区沙龙online [腾讯云中间件]
腾讯云GAME-TECH沙龙
领取专属 10元无门槛券
手把手带您无忧上云